Stadium Power manufactures an unrivalled range of competitively priced LED drivers for a wide range of indoor and outdoor use in LED based lighting and signage applications. Seven standard ranges are available which feature advanced specifications including; full universal AC input range, active PFC (Class C), over voltage and over current protection, IP67 rating for indoor and outdoor applications, free air convection cooled, optional output voltage and current control and -25 °C +70 °C operating temperature range.  Custom designs are available to meet specific power requirements or environmental conditions.

Models include the encapsulated low cost, high efficiency, single output DC:DC MDL LED driver. Offering a wide input range, step up or step down operation, PWM and analogue dimming control and up to 24 W output at 300 to 1000 mA the MDL is intended to drive LED strings from 2 V to 28 V.

Two open-frame models, the 48 W SA48CV and 60 W SA60CC, feature active power factor correction (PFC) to EN61000-3-2 PFC Class C. The SA60CC provides constant current and dimming control available via PWM, 0 to 10 Vdc or 0 to 5 Vdc.

Enclosed models include the low cost, low standby power SA10CC which is a 10 to 18 W led driver cased to Class ll requirements and features low conducted and radiated EMC. The HPF10 10W model may be programmable via external voltage, potentiometer or PWM.

For outdoor or use in harsh environments the HSF LED driver IP67 rated for indoor and outdoor applications, is available with output power from 60 to 300 W and an optional low cost range rated from 10 to 28 W is available. With an operating temperature range of -25 °C to +70 °C, the HSF LED power supply is free air convection cooled and offers optional output voltage and current control.
